Linux
 Computer >> コンピューター >  >> システム >> Linux

MidnightCommanderで圧縮ファイルを管理する方法

MidnightCommanderで圧縮ファイルを管理する方法

圧縮されたアーカイブを頻繁に扱いますか?デスクトップでこれを行うのは簡単ですが、サーバー環境では、圧縮ファイルを管理するのが難しい場合があります。 Midnight Commanderを使用すると、多数のファイルとフォルダーをすばやく選択して、GZアーカイブに圧縮できます。また、BZアーカイブのコンテンツを抽出したり、それらのアーカイブを入力して、特定のファイルをアーカイブに追加したり、アーカイブから抽出したりすることもできます。方法を見てみましょう。

インストール

Midnight Commander(略してMC)はほとんどのLinuxディストリビューションにプリインストールされていませんが、リポジトリにあります。 Ubuntu、Debian、および互換性のあるディストリビューションにインストールするには、お気に入りの端末を入力して使用します:

sudo apt install mc
MidnightCommanderで圧縮ファイルを管理する方法

Red Hatを使用している場合は、次のコマンドでインストールできます:

sudo yum install mc

アーチファンは、以下を使用してそれを機内に持ち込むことができます:

sudo pacman -S mc

Suseの場合は、次を試してください:

sudo zypper install mc
MidnightCommanderで圧縮ファイルを管理する方法

32ビットWindowsXP以降と互換性のあるMicrosoftOS用のMidnightCommanderのネイティブポートがあるため、Windowsファンは除外されません。インストーラーはSourceForgeページからダウンロードして、コンピューター上の他のアプリケーションと同じようにインストールできます。

初回実行

Midnight Commanderをインストールした後、mcと入力して、ターミナルから実行できます。 。

MidnightCommanderで圧縮ファイルを管理する方法

MidnightCommanderは2つのペインを表示します。現在使用しているアクティブなもの(デフォルトでは左側)が、すべてのファイルアクションのソースとして使用されます。もう1つは宛先として機能します。左側のペインで一連のファイルを選択し、 F5を押した場合 、「コピー」にマップされ、選択したファイルが右ペインに表示されるディレクトリにコピーされます。

Tab を押すと、2つのペイン間を移動できます。 キーボードで。 10個のファンクションキーは、MidnightCommanderの画面の下部に表示される機能のショートカットとして機能します。

MidnightCommanderで圧縮ファイルを管理する方法

デフォルトでは、MCはソートにファイル名を使用します。すべての画像ファイルをバンドルする必要があるため、ファイル拡張子に基づいてコンテンツを並べ替えます。

F9を押します MCのプルダウンメニューにアクセスします。

MidnightCommanderで圧縮ファイルを管理する方法

「並べ替え順序…」を選択し、表示されるオプションから「内線番号」に変更します。

MidnightCommanderで圧縮ファイルを管理する方法

その後、左側のペインのすべてのファイルは、ファイル名ではなく拡張子に基づいて並べ替えられます。

MidnightCommanderで圧縮ファイルを管理する方法

個々のファイルとフォルダを圧縮する

リストを上下にスクロールして、挿入を押します。 エントリを選択(または選択解除)します。 MCは、選択したエントリを異なる色で表示します。

MidnightCommanderで圧縮ファイルを管理する方法

選択したすべてのエントリをアーカイブに圧縮するには、 F2を押します。 ファイルメニューにアクセスします。カーソルキーを使用して「Gzipまたはgunzipタグ付きファイル」または「Bzip2またはbunzip2タグ付きファイル」に移動し、Enterキーを押してアーカイブに使用する形式を選択します。 Y のショートカットを使用すると、さらに高速になります。 GzipおよびBの場合 Bzip2の場合。

MidnightCommanderで圧縮ファイルを管理する方法

ターミナルに一時的にジャンプすると、同じフォルダにファイルの圧縮バージョンが表示されます。

MidnightCommanderで圧縮ファイルを管理する方法

選択したすべてのファイルを単一のアーカイブに圧縮する

選択したすべてのファイルを単一のアーカイブに圧縮したい場合はどうなりますか? Midnight Commanderにはデフォルトでそのような機能は含まれていませんが、半手動で行うことができます。

以前と同じようにファイルの束を選択します。

MidnightCommanderで圧縮ファイルを管理する方法

F2を押します もう一度ファイルメニューにアクセスします。今回は@を押します または、「タグ付けされたファイルに対して何かを行う」を選択します。このオプションを使用すると、ファイルの選択に作用するコマンドを手動で入力できます。

MidnightCommanderで圧縮ファイルを管理する方法

好みのアーカイバのコマンドを使用して、複数のファイルを1つのアーカイブに追加しますが、ファイル自体を%sに置き換えます。 。このパラメータは、「アクティブなペインで選択されたすべて」に対応します。

たとえば、ファイルを7z形式で圧縮するには、次を使用しました。

7z a ARCHIVE_NAME.7z %s
MidnightCommanderで圧縮ファイルを管理する方法

その後すぐに、選択したファイルを含むアーカイブが同じフォルダに表示されました。

MidnightCommanderで圧縮ファイルを管理する方法

ファイルの抽出

MCを使用すると、圧縮アーカイブの抽出がさらに簡単になります。仮想ファイルシステムを使用してそれらをボリュームとしてマウントすることにより、コンテンツを抽出して再圧縮することなく、コンテンツを操作できます。

アーカイブ全体を抽出するには、アーカイブを選択してから F2を押します。 。 Zを押します または、「圧縮されたtarファイルをサブディレクトリに抽出する」を選択してこれを行います。ただし、MCを使用すると、特定のファイルまたはフォルダのみが必要な場合は、すべてを抽出する必要はありません。

アーカイブが強調表示された状態で、Enterキーを押して入力します。はい、これは冗長に聞こえますが、MCを使用するとアーカイブ内にアクセスしてコンテンツを管理できるため、まさにそれが起こります。

MidnightCommanderで圧縮ファイルを管理する方法

通常のフォルダと同じように、アーカイブ内で個々のファイルとフォルダを選択して、 F5を押すことができます。 それらを宛先ペインにコピー(抽出)します。 F6を押すこともできます それらをそこに移動します。つまり、宛先ペインに抽出された後、アーカイブから削除されます。 F8を押すこともできます アーカイブから何かを削除します。

MidnightCommanderで圧縮ファイルを管理する方法

また、しばらくの間通常のターミナルに戻りたい場合は、MidnightCommanderを終了する必要がないことにも注意してください。 Ctrlを押します + O 同時に、MCはバックグラウンドで非表示になり、起動したターミナルに残ります。

同じショートカットを使用してMCに戻ることができます。 MCを実際に終了するには、 F10を押します。 キーボードで。

圧縮ファイルをより適切に管理するもう1つの方法は、自己解凍型アーカイブを作成して、追加のアプリケーションのインストールについて心配する必要がないようにすることです。


  1. Windows タグでファイルとフォルダを管理する方法

    システムから古いファイルを検索することは、炭庫で黒猫を探すようなものです。たとえば、昨年の南アメリカでの休暇の写真はどこに保存したのでしょうか。または 2018 年に書いたレポートの名前は? Windows 10 には強力な検索機能が組み込まれていますが、特に Cortana を使用すると、画像、音楽、PDF などのフィルターを使用してスマートに検索できます。最も無視されている機能の 1 つである Windows タグ 効率的な方法でファイルを検索して整理するのは理にかなっています。 Windows タグとは何か、なぜそれを使用する必要があるのか​​? タグは、Windows 10 の最も

  2. Cloud Tuneup Pro でディスク容量の消費を管理する方法

    ハードディスクの空き容量が不足していませんか?新しいハードディスクを購入する代わりに、Windows 10 PC のディスク容量を管理する最初のステップ。 Windows 10 のストレージ管理とは、すべてのファイルとフォルダーを特定し、冗長なファイルや不要なファイルを削除して、より多くのストレージ スペースを作成することを意味します。このタスクは、PC のクリーニングとメンテナンスを含む最適化プロセスの 1 つの主要なモジュールと見なされます。 さまざまな方法でコンピュータを最適化し、貴重なストレージ スペースを回復できますが、「物理的に同じ場所にない PC でも実行できますか?」 ま